Should keratin treatment be applied to wet or dry hair?

A keratin treatment is applied to washed and fully dried hair, and is not rinsed out before you blow dry and straighten your locks. The treatment should stay in your hair for at least two days before you wash your hair again, during which time you should avoid wearing hair ties or clips.

Can I oil my hair after keratin treatment?

Yes. Pure Argan oil is safe to use on keratin-treated hair. Be sure to use pure Argan oil with no added chemicals that can react with keratin in your hair. Olive oil is also completely safe to use on keratin-straightened hair, as it is naturally derived.

Why is my hair still frizzy after keratin treatment?

"After any Keratin Treatment, the Moisture vs. Protein balance in our hair will be "out-of-sync" due to the high protein concentration used during the procedure. This will cause hair to feel rough, coarse and brittle in the short or long term if nothing is done to counteract it.

Can you use sulfate free shampoo for keratin?

Do not use dry shampoos or other products in the hair for the three-day period. Once they have shampooed, they must use sulfate free shampoo and conditioner or the recommended aftercare product from the manufacturer every time they wash. Using non-sulfate-free products can cause the keratin treatment to revert.

Is keratin shot safe?

The safety of keratin treatments has been in the news lately as some products have been shown to contain dangerous amounts of formaldehyde. Two great options on the market are Keratin Shot by Salerm Cosmetics and the Keratin Complex by Peter Coppola. Both contain little to no formaldehyde. 02.

1. Keep your hair dry

After keratin treatment is applied to your hair, it is highly advised to not wash your hair immediately after treatment. Hairdressers highly recommend to wait at least 12 hours, but it’s better to avoid washing your hair for three days. After the stated period of time, you can go ahead and wash your hair.

2. Keep your hair down

The first three days are absolutely important for the keratin treatment. During this period, strictly avoid putting your hair on a ponytail or in any hairstyle that evolves hair ties or clips. Why? When you just treat the hair, it is in a very vulnerable state that can affect it’s final look after the treatment settles.

3.Wash your hair less often

In order to maintain the look for a longer time, it is advisable to wash your hair less often. This is due to the fact that the results wash out gradually. As stated earlier, be careful of exposing your hair to high levels of chlorine or saltwater.

4. Use right shampoo and conditioner

Regular shampoos are good but they don’t work perfectly with Keratin. After the keratin treatment, it is best to use specialized, natural shampoo and conditioners that are free of chemicals and salt that can stip the keratin of the hair.

5. Avoid cotton pillowcases

In general, cotton pillowcases are not a good idea for your hair, especially if you have keratin-treated hair. Cotton can create friction and damage your hair, which is why it is highly recommended to avoid sleeping on a cotton pillowcase. Instead, try using a silk pillowcase or at least a material-like silk.

6.Wear a cap

Always ensure you wear a cap when you are going for a swim. The reason being that the chlorine from the swimming pool and salt from the ocean can strip the keratin treatment out of your hair. In addition, make sure to always cover your hair when you’re exposed to the sun, as the high UV levels, can damage any hair (even not keratin-treated hair).

7.Refresh The Treatment

After 12 weeks, the results of the keratin treatment will be less obvious. Since our hair always keeps growing, after approximately 3 months, the untreated roots of your natural hair will be apparent. Applying new keratin will help you to extend the keratin treatment results.
